Historic papers on show online

-

HUNDREDS of ‘extremely rare’ documents giving an insight into Scotland’s history have been posted online.

The National Library of Scotland has digitised more than 240 medieval and early modern manuscript­s ranging from the ninth to the 1 th centuries.

They include a medicine and zodiac almanac and rules about beards and moustaches for the Knights Templar.

Manuscript­s curator Dr Ulrike Hogg said: ‘This fascinatin­g digitised collection is internatio­nal in origin, though a large part of the volumes were written in Scotland. We’re delighted to make these extremely rare pieces of history publicly accessible online.’

The collection can be viewed at Early manuscript­s – National Library of Scotland (nls.uk)
